Biography

Dr. Erin Searcy is currently the Acting Deputy Laboratory Director, Science and Technology, and Chief Research Officer.  Dr. Searcy has had several roles at INL since joining in 2008, including Bioenergy Technologies Department Manager, Bioenergy Platform Analysis Lead, principle investigator on several biomass feedstock logistics and sustainability projects, and techno-economic analyst. Dr. Searcy spent almost three years supporting the Bioenergy Technologies Office in Washington, D.C., as a management and operations person employed by the INL.

After completing her bachelor’s and master’s degrees in engineering, Dr. Searcy worked as an environmental engineering consultant. She holds a Ph.D. in mechanical engineering, and acted as a sessional instructor in the Department of Mechanical Engineering at the University of Alberta.
